One-Step Flow Matching for Generative Modeling of Path-Dependent Physical Fields
A one-step flow matching model using transformer in VAE latent space with non-Gaussian source and auxiliary networks generates accurate high-resolution path-dependent stress fields, achieving 6-7x CPU and ~100x GPU speedup over FEM.
